<p>Mon Guadalupe,</p>
<p>I left you with my patriotic</p>
<p>sash around my waist, tight</p>
<p>and thick as satin fabric,</p>
<p>that turns with every hip to thigh</p>
<p>extension.  I walk the runway,</p>
<p>out in open air.</p>
<p>The people wave flags:</p>
<p>green, orange and reds.</p>
<p>And like it’s carnival time,</p>
<p>steel drums bang their beats,</p>
<p>guitars straighten their strings,</p>
<p>I’m dancing</p>
<p>under this heat, like a mosquito</p>
<p>trying to sting human skin.</p>
<p>I taste the blood of success.</p>
<p><br class="spacer_" /></p>
<p>France,</p>
<p>I’m you today, able to suck</p>
<p>the blood out of living creatures.</p>
<p>I am a conqueror,</p>
<p>parading on stage,</p>
<p>smiling with grace and thankfulness,</p>
<p>colonizing one country after another</p>
<p>like Napoleon,</p>
<p>but taller with bronze skin.</p>
<p>I have the world’s golden crown</p>
<p><br class="spacer_" /></p>
<p>[1] Veronique De La Cruz was the first black woman to win the Miss France title and go on to the Miss Universe contest in 1993.</p>
